Courses delivered through OntarioLearn are a collection of shared online college courses. In collaboration with all 24 of Ontario’s publicly-funded colleges you have access to an extensive selection of online programs, courses and services.
Choose the course you want to take and begin the registration process by contacting ontariolearn@northern.on.ca. Purchase your textbook(s) if required, prior to the start date by going to www.textnet.ca and searching for your textbook by course name.
